Development of Online Curriculum for Eight-Week Program: The Art of Teaching English to EFL Students from Russia
Ekaterina Tabenkina
ProQuest LLC, Ed.D. Dissertation, Alliant International University
The present project is a research-based and practice-tested online synchronous curriculum for English language learners with the Russian language mother tongue. The curriculum's theoretical component is grounded in Vygotsky's, Leont'ev', and Engestrom's "Cultural Historical Activity Theory" as well as in scholarly papers on the influence of non-educational and educational and linguistic factors on the English language teaching in Russia. As for the practical component, the designer examined the roots of the most common mistakes by the English language learners from Russia and purposed the curriculum objectives at eliminating the main errors in reading, writing, speaking and grammar skills and at mastering the pronunciation of the most difficult combinations of consonants for the Russian language speakers. The curriculum was designed for an eight-week program with a frequency of three hours teaching per week and with a total of 48 hours of instruction. The students in the program are recommended at the B-2 - Upper-Intermediate - level of the English language proficiency. All lessons materials were developed to be taught in a PowerPoint presentation format via Zoom or other e-teaching platforms. However, the universal design of the curriculum allows EL instructors to modify the curriculum for face-to-face teaching formats depending on the availability of a computer and materials thereof.
